Xavien Howard and Connor Williams will be sitting out the Miami Dolphins' game against the Philadelphia Eagles on Sunday night. This news was revealed in a tweet by the username 'AroundTheNFL'. The tweet also provided a link to the official inactives for the game. The absence of Howard and Williams is a significant development for the Dolphins, as they will be without key players in their matchup against the Eagles.
